Definition Of Preventive Care

Preventive care encompasses routine check-ups, vaccinations, and screenings aimed at catching health issues early. It includes services like dental cleanings, flea and tick prevention, and spaying or neutering. These services are designed to keep your pet healthy and are often included in comprehensive pet insurance plans.

Heartworm Prevention

Heartworm is a silent threat that can cause life-threatening damage to your pet’s heart and lungs. Fortunately, pet insurance can cover heartworm preventive measures, such as monthly chewable tablets or injections. Regular heartworm prevention is critical, especially if you live in areas where mosquitoes are prevalent, as they are the primary transmitters. By addressing heartworm prevention, you ensure your pet remains healthy and active without the worry of a costly treatment plan.

Limitations And Exclusions

Pet insurance offers peace of mind. But, it’s essential to understand its limitations and exclusions. Policies may not cover every aspect of preventive care. Knowing these details helps in making informed choices.

Age Restrictions

Age can impact coverage. Many policies have age limits for coverage. Older pets might face exclusions or higher premiums. Puppies and kittens often receive more comprehensive coverage. Always check the policy for age-related terms. Some insurers may not cover pets beyond a certain age. This ensures they manage risk effectively. Understanding age restrictions prevents unexpected surprises.

Breed-specific Conditions

Breed-specific conditions are another consideration. Certain breeds have unique health risks. Insurance companies may exclude these from coverage. For example, Bulldogs often face respiratory issues. Policies may not cover these pre-existing conditions. Knowing your pet’s breed-specific risks is crucial. It helps in evaluating potential insurance policies. Always read the fine print regarding breed-related exclusions. This knowledge can save time and money.
